Handover note from Dessa to Ruvin: the Copperline queue's log compaction job was tuned last sprint after segment files ballooned on the ingest brokers. Compaction now runs hourly and retains tombstones for seven days, which the security team asked us to verify against retention policy. Nothing else changed on the brokers. The active compaction configuration on the primary cluster is shown below.

config for tawif-bagef:
[sorwyn]
team = sorys
access_code = ac_9ba40c
host = sorwyn.ordingrid.local
port = 5000
owner = aldok.quenion
peer = belath.paliqcloud.local

Ticket BRIDLE-412 — Telemetry gateway buffer fix, sign-off required. The Plowshare gateway dropped telemetry frames from harvesters when the upstream link flapped for more than 90 seconds; the ring buffer overwrote unacked frames. This patch persists unacked frames to disk and replays them in order on reconnect. Reviewer: please verify the replay ordering test and the disk-quota guard. Final sign-off on this change belongs to:

named custodian: Belius Casath Ulaix Sorius

As of the Larchwood 4.2 release, payroll exports moved from fixed-width files to the column-delimited PXF-2 format. Downstream consumers in Finance Ops were migrated in March; a few legacy batch jobs still read the old layout through a shim maintained by the Ledgerline team. New team members should not modify the export mapper without a ticket approved by the payroll data owners. Questions about field ordering, padding, or the deprecation timeline for the shim should go to the payroll integrations group.

escalation mailbox, yajef-hawef: druix@qirvancorp.internal